Jon Hamm Reveals Why He's Not Married

Jon Hamm may play a womanizer on "Mad Men," but in real life, the actor is nothing like philandering ad executive Don Draper -- especially when it comes to relationships.

In the April issue of ELLE UK, on newsstands Friday, Hamm opens up about why he isn't married to longtime girlfriend Jennifer Westfeldt.

"The flip answer is, if it ain't broke don't fix it," the actor said of their 15-year relationship. "The better version of that is, that any relationship is a day-in-day-out process."

Hamm adds that the couple is dedicated to one another, even if they aren't married. "Having a piece of paper serves to remind you of your commitment, but we do a pretty good job of reminding each other," he told the magazine.

In July 2010, he told Parade: "Jen is the love of my life, and we've already been together four times longer than my parents were married."

He added: "I don't have the marriage chip, and neither of us have the greatest examples of marriages in our families."

The pair first met at a party in 1997. Hamm and Westfeldt star in "Friends With Kids," written and directed by Westfeldt, which hits theaters Friday.
